Site Manager role in Bromley | April start | Permanent
We are working with a flourishing secondary school in Bromley seeking a dedicated Site Manager for an April 2026 start. This full-time role is central to the school’s daily operations and long-term infrastructure planning.
The Role The successful candidate will lead by example, providing the technical support required to ensure a safe and inspiring environment for all students and staff. We are looking for an individual who thrives in a well-ordered workplace where professional excellence is the standard. Key duties include managing the school's heating and security systems, prioritising reactive repairs, and ensuring the grounds are maintained to a "beacon of excellence" standard.

Start Date: April 2026 | Contract: Full-Time, Permanent
Salary Range: £33,500 – £39,500 (Outer London Scale)
Nearest Station: Bromley South (National Rail)
Benefits: Local government pension scheme, eye care vouchers, and retail discount portal.
